TDQS
Scored across 3 tools
Each tool targets a distinct operation: retrieving a judgment by ID, general search, and search by case number. There is no overlap in functionality.
Tool names mostly follow a verb_noun or verb_preposition_noun pattern, but 'search' is just a verb while 'get_judgment' uses get. However, 'search_by_case' is descriptive and consistent with 'search'.
Three tools are appropriate for a focused database query server. Each tool serves a clear purpose without redundancy.
Core operations (search and retrieve) are present, but there are gaps: no pagination for search results, and full judgment text is limited to 2000 characters. Missing features like listing courts or fetching full text could hinder some workflows.
